About Harlem sympathy

How Harlem sends sympathy flowers.

Harlem is the historic capital of Black American culture, and its sympathy flower demand is shaped by the church more than by any other force. The Abyssinian Baptist and Mother AME Zion historic-church corridor drives heavy homegoing-service, funeral, and gospel-Sunday volume, and a Harlem sympathy send needs a florist who knows the service times along the corridor, which churches and funeral homes accept large standing pieces, and which entrances they come through. Abyssinian Baptist Church (132 Odell Clark Place / W 138th St), Mother AME Zion Church (140 W 137th St), Canaan Baptist, and First Corinthian Baptist in the former Regent Theater on 116th all take standing sprays, casket pieces, and altar arrangements timed to the service schedule. Sympathy work also routes to the family home along the Lenox Avenue and Strivers' Row brownstone blocks, and to the bereavement liaison at NYC Health+Hospitals/Harlem (506 Lenox Ave) and Mount Sinai Morningside for a hospital passing. The traditional palette here runs to white lily, gladiolus, rose, and chrysanthemum standing work — the homegoing look the corridor expects.

What sympathy arrangement is most appropriate for a Harlem homegoing service?
For a homegoing service along the church corridor, the traditional standing spray on an easel — white lily, gladiolus, rose, and chrysanthemum — is the expected piece, sized for the altar or the front of the sanctuary ($165-350). A casket spray or blanket sits on the casket itself ($295-695). For the family home, a condolence hand-tied or a peace lily plant is appropriate ($90-165). Marine Florists carries the full standing-spray and casket-piece catalog; Starbrightnyc handles the family-home and altar hand-tied work. Studios match the piece to the service so it reads correctly in the room.
